Job Description
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Senior Manager or Director of Software Development to lead and scale our global software delivery organization. This strategic role oversees the entire software development lifecycle from planning to team leadership and project execution. The successful candidate will lead cross-functional teams including Project Management, Business Analysis, Software Development, and Quality Assurance. The ideal candidate will bring a strong technical background, proven leadership in telecom environments, and the ability to execute with precision at both strategic and tactical levels.
Key Responsibilities
Leadership & Oversight
Lead and mentor a diverse team of PMs, BAs, Developers, and QA professionals across international locations.
Foster a high-performance culture through coaching, clear KPIs, and continuous improvement.
Collaborate closely with executive leadership and cross-functional teams to align software initiatives with company goals.
Be highly available for and regularly synched with Senior Management for tight alignment and speed.
Project & Delivery Management
Drive end-to-end delivery of complex software projects on time, within budget, and to specification.
Ensure clear documentation, requirements gathering, and change management processes are followed.
Implement and refine agile development practices and project management methodologies.
Technical Execution
Provide architectural guidance and technical direction where needed — this is a hands-on leadership role.
Be innovative in solutions and where appropriate enhance the outcome leveraging experience and understanding of the vision.
Review code, troubleshoot issues, and engage directly with development teams when appropriate.
Evaluate and implement tools, frameworks, and best practices that improve development efficiency and product quality.
Stay current with industry trends and best practices in software development.
Global Team Management
Manage distributed teams across multiple time zones with a focus on communication, accountability, and results.
Establish scalable structures, processes, and reporting to ensure visibility and operational excellence.
Promote a collaborative environment that values innovation, accountability, and diversity.
Qualifications
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.
10+ years of experience in software development, with at least 5 years in a leadership role managing technical teams.
Experience in the telecommunications industry or similar high-availability, high-scale systems.
Strong technical background in enterprise software architecture, cloud-based platforms, and modern development languages (e.g., Java, Python, .NET).
Proven ability to manage complex, global development organizations and drive large-scale initiatives.
Comfortable rolling up your sleeves when needed — whether reviewing code, stepping into technical conversations, or resolving project blockers.
Bring high energy and a can do attitude that will foster greater creativity and results.
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to engage stakeholders at all levels.
Preferred Skills
Familiarity with OSS/BSS systems, APIs, and a broad spectrum of telecom network technologies.
Experience with tools such as Jira, Confluence, Git, CI/CD pipelines, and c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P).
Track record of building and scaling international teams in a fast-paced, growth-focused environment.
